Official title

The Effect of HFA-beclomethasone Dipropionate on Static Lung Volumes in COPD

Brief summary

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.

This is an investigator-sponsored research study to evaluate if treatment with HFA-134a beclomethasone (QVAR) has an effect on peripheral (or outer) airway inflammation and airway "remodeling" or scarring in subjects with COPD. Approximately 20 subjects with COPD will participate for approximately 7 weeks, with 10 receiving an active (BDP) inhaler with HFA-134a and 10 receiving a placebo.
